DAY 1 & DAY 2: MAY 28 & MAY 29 – HONOLULU – OSAKA

Board our international flight from Honolulu to Osaka. Meals on board. Upon arrival at Kansai International Airport on Day 2, an Air & Sea Travel representative will greet us and transfer us to our hotel near Universal Studios Japan. Check in, relax, and prepare for our journey across Japan.

Osaka By Night

DAY 3: MAY 30 – OSAKA – NARA – OSAKA (B, L)

After breakfast, travel to Nara, Japan’s historic ancient capital. Visit Nara Park, home to 1,200 sacred free-roaming sika deer, and explore Todaiji Temple, a UNESCO site housing the Great Buddha. Enjoy a traditional Japanese Tea Ceremony, then return to Osaka to explore Shinsaibashi Shopping Street and the vibrant Dotonbori district, famous for its neon lights and Glico Running Man sign. DAY 4: MAY 31 – OSAKA – KYOTO – OSAKA (B)

Travel to Kyoto to visit UNESCO-listed Kiyomizu-dera, renowned for its massive wooden stage. Stroll through historic Ninen-zaka and Sannen-zaka streets, then visit the iconic Kinkaku-ji (Golden Pavilion). Participate in a hands-on Kyo-Yuzen craft activity to dye your own tote bag using traditional kimono techniques. Return to Osaka for an evening at leisure with dinner on your own.

DAY 6: JUN 2 – OSAKA – HAKONE (B, D)

Board the bullet train from Shin-Osaka to Mishima Station, enjoying a train bento box for lunch on your own. Transfer to scenic Hakone to visit historic Hakone Shrine on Lake Ashi, take a sightseeing lake cruise, and ride the Hakone Ropeway for views of Owakudani and Mount Fuji. Check into our hot spring hotel for a relaxing soak and group dinner.

DAY 7: JUN 3 – HAKONE – YOKOHAMA – TOKYO (B, D)

Travel to Yokohama for an interactive workshop at the Cup Noodles Museum to make custom instant ramen. Next, explore vibrant Yokohama Chinatown with free time for lunch and shopping. Continue to Tokyo, check into our hotel, and enjoy a group dinner at a local restaurant.

DAY 8: JUN 4 – TOKYO (DISNEYSEA) (B)

Spend the day at Tokyo DisneySea, the world’s only ocean-themed Disney park. Discover unique themed lands, including Fantasy Springs, Mediterranean Harbor, and Mysterious Island. Enjoy magical attractions and shows at your own pace, with convenient hotel shuttle service.

DAY 10: JUN 6 – TOKYO – HONOLULU (B)

Begin with a hands-on activity making a realistic Japanese food sample fruit parfait. Next, explore Toyosu Senkyaku Banrai for local seafood and delicacies on your own. Visit historic Senso-ji Temple and Nakamise-dori in Asakusa before transferring to Narita Airport for our return flight back to Honolulu.

PHYSICAL RANGE: LEVEL 2–3 | MODERATE TO ACTIVE

Most sightseeing involves 1–2 miles of walking on paved areas, while Kyoto, Nara, Asakusa, Universal Studios Japan, and Tokyo DisneySea may require 2–4 miles, extended standing, stairs, and some uneven surfaces. No strenuous hiking or demanding terrain is included.
